No Impact on a VM when Using the fstrim Command to Save Space

Impact of fstrim Command on VM

Safety and Normal Operation

The fstrim command is generally safe to run on a VM and is considered a standard maintenance operation. It’s designed to be non-destructive and only discards blocks that are already marked as unused by the filesystem.

Potential Impacts During Execution

Performance Considerations

  • Temporary I/O increase: fstrim generates disk I/O activity while scanning and discarding unused blocks
  • Brief performance degradation: The VM may experience slower disk response times during the operation
  • CPU usage: Minimal CPU impact, primarily I/O bound operation
  • Duration: Depends on disk size and amount of unused space (typically minutes for a 93GB disk)

What Actually Happens

  • fstrim sends TRIM/DISCARD commands for unused blocks to the underlying storage
  • In your case with QCOW2, it allows the host to reclaim unused space from the image file
  • Only affects genuinely unused blocks - no data loss occurs
  • The filesystem remains fully accessible during the operation

Best Practices for Running fstrim

  1. Run during low-activity periods if possible (though not strictly necessary)
  2. Start with a specific mount point: sudo fstrim -v / before using -a for all mount points
  3. Monitor the output - it will show how much space was trimmed
  4. The VM remains fully operational - no downtime required

The command is reversible in the sense that if space is needed again, the QCOW2 file will simply grow back as required.
